Sec. 5. Any person, firm or cor-
tion carrying on or engaging in any
business or occupation enumerated
in this Ordinance, without first hav-
ing procured a license therefor, shall
be guilty of a misdemeanor and on
conviction thereof in the police
court of said city shall be fined not
less than five dollars nor more than
one hundred dollars, or be impris-
oned in the city jail not less than
Ordi-1 flVe days nor more than sixty days.
rPffu a" or both such fine and imprisonment;

For a permit to cover any and all I
building or single plant as may
under one ownership or management,
on such plant or boundaries as def-
initely specified under the permit, an
annua) fee ol $1 2 00 shall be charg-
ed. A monthly inspection shall be
made of the installation covered by
this permit. The inspector making
this inspection shall sign the orig-
inal permit after cacti Inspection,
provided the work is in accordance
with the rules as specified
Ordinance.

Jamaica Ginger Output.
The ginger grown In Jamaica com-
mands more than double the price of
any other. Under favorable conditions
an acre will produce as much as 4,000
pounds. During the last fiscal year
about 1,400,000 pounds was exported
> from that Island.
